Snap-on Tools Mobile Developer Salary

The average Snap-on Tools Mobile Developer earns an estimated $80,920 annually. Snap-on Tools' Mobile Developer compensation is $30,850 less than the US average for a Mobile Developer.

The Engineering Department at Snap-on Tools earns $3,979 more on average than the Sales Department.

Mobile Developer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Mobile Developer at companies similar size to Snap-on Tools reported making $116,167, while the average male Mobile Developer at similar sized companies reported making $127,457.

Mobile Developer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Hispanic or Latino Mobile Developer at companies similar size to Snap-on Tools reported making $148,667, while the average African American/Black Mobile Developer at similar sized companies reported making $74,500.

How Mobile Developers at Snap-on Tools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Mobile Developers at Snap-on Tools believe they're not compensated fairly. 75% of Mobile Developers at Snap-on Tools say they receive annual bonuses, and the majority (60%) are satisfied with their benefits. See more compensation ratings at Snap-on Tools
